Bruce Talbert (1838-1881) A Carved Oak Hall Chair, In The Manner Of Gillows, 1870's

£295    $400    €348
Many of Bruce Talbert''s designs were executed by Gillows and this chair may well have been made by the firm. The seat rail stamped J. McCluskey, presumably the chair maker and carver, with owner and design registration numbers on the front and back rails.
 
The hand-carved finials are much more labour intensive than more typical turned equivalents and suggest a specific one-off commsion rather than a more widely produced production design.
 
Well presented and structurally sound, minor chips to extremities of the back legs
